Food & Dining in Rusororo
Rusororo's culinary landscape offers a delightful exploration of Rwandan flavours, blending traditional staples with emerging international influences. The region's cuisine is characterized by fresh, locally sourced ingredients, with staples like plantains, cassava, potatoes, and beans forming the backbone of many dishes. For visitors, experiencing the local food scene is an integral part of understanding the culture. Expect hearty meals, often served in generous portions, reflecting the warmth and hospitality of Rwandan people.
When seeking authentic dining experiences in Rusororo, exploring neighbourhoods like Kimihurura and Nyarutarama can be particularly rewarding. These areas often host a variety of restaurants, from casual eateries to more upscale establishments. For Muslim travellers, finding Halal-certified options is becoming increasingly feasible, especially in areas with a more diverse population or those catering to international visitors. It is always advisable to inquire directly with restaurants about their Halal practices to ensure compliance with dietary needs.
The cost of dining in Rusororo offers excellent value for international travellers. Street food and local eateries can provide a filling meal for as little as $2-5 USD (approximately ₱ 110-275), while mid-range restaurants typically charge between $10-20 USD (roughly ₱ 550-1,100) per person for a main course and drink. Upscale dining experiences might range from $25-40 USD (around ₱ 1,375-2,200) or more. This affordability allows visitors from the US, Europe, and India to savour a wide array of local and international dishes without significant budget strain.
Practical dining tips for Rusororo include understanding local meal times, which generally align with Western schedules but can be more relaxed. Tipping is not always customary but is appreciated for excellent service, with a small amount (5-10%) being appropriate. When ordering, politeness and patience are key. Familiarize yourself with basic Kinyarwanda phrases if possible, though English and French are widely understood in tourist-oriented establishments. Embracing the local dining customs will undoubtedly enrich your culinary journey.
Local Etiquette & Safety in Rusororo
Understanding local etiquette is crucial for a respectful and enriching visit to Rusororo. Rwandans are known for their politeness and respect for elders and authority. Greetings are important; a simple "Mwaramutse" (Good morning) or "Mwiriwe" (Hello/Good afternoon) goes a long way. When visiting homes or more traditional settings, it's customary to be invited in and to wait to be seated. Public displays of affection are generally frowned upon, and dressing modestly, especially when visiting rural areas or religious sites, is advisable.
When staying at accommodations like ECOAIR VILLA or Cathy's Apartment, general etiquette applies. Respect the property and its staff by being mindful of noise levels, especially during quiet hours. Photography of people should always be done with permission. Queuing is generally orderly, and patience is appreciated. While tourist-facing establishments are accustomed to international visitors, observing and adapting to local customs will foster positive interactions and a deeper appreciation for Rwandan culture.
Safety in Rusororo is generally good, with low crime rates compared to many global cities. However, like any travel destination, it's wise to take precautions. Keep valuables secure and avoid displaying them ostentatiously. For transportation, using reputable ride-hailing apps like Bolt or local taxis is recommended. These services are generally reliable and affordable. Familiarizing yourself with offline maps and having a local SIM card can also be very helpful for navigation and communication, ensuring you can easily get around the region.

Travel Guide to Rusororo
Reaching Rusororo from the Philippines involves international travel, typically with one or more layovers. Flights from major Philippine hubs like Manila (MNL) or Cebu (CEB) to Kigali International Airport (KGL), the primary gateway serving Rusororo, usually involve connections in Middle Eastern or European cities. The total travel time can range from 18 to 30 hours or more, depending on the layover duration and route. While direct flights are uncommon, numerous airlines offer competitive fares, making it accessible for Filipino travellers. Booking your book flight in advance can secure better prices.
Once you arrive at Kigali International Airport, Rusororo is a short drive away. The most convenient way to get around Rusororo and its surrounding areas is by using taxis or ride-hailing services like Bolt, which are readily available and reasonably priced. For exploring further afield or for a more immersive experience, hiring a car with a driver can be a good option, offering flexibility and local insights. Public transport, such as minibuses, exists but can be crowded and less predictable for tourists unfamiliar with the routes.
The best time to visit Rusororo generally falls within the dry seasons, from June to September and December to February. During these periods, the weather is pleasant, with less rainfall, making it ideal for outdoor activities and exploration. These months can be considered peak season, potentially leading to higher accommodation prices and more visitors. The shoulder seasons, however, can offer a good balance of favourable weather and fewer crowds, providing a more relaxed travel experience.
Before departing for Rusororo, ensure you have your essential travel documents in order, including a valid passport with at least six months of validity remaining. While USD is widely accepted in tourist establishments, it's advisable to carry some Rwandan Francs (RWF) for smaller purchases and local markets. Purchasing a local SIM card upon arrival at the airport can be cost-effective for staying connected. Essential apps to download include offline maps, a translation app, and the ride-hailing service you plan to use.
